Competitor based pricing for hotels: A complete guide

Hospitality Net

Competitor-based pricing or competition-based pricing is a data-driven approach where businesses use advanced analytics to set their prices based on competitors’ rates. In the hotel industry, this involves leveraging sophisticated pricing algorithms and software to monitor, in real-time, the room rates of comparable hotels.

CoStar: U.S. Hotel Performance Increases Overall

Lodging

WASHINGTON—U.S. hotel performance increased from the previous week and showed positive year-over-year comparisons, according to CoStar’s latest data through Nov. 11, 2023. U.S. Hotel Performance November 5-11, 2023 Percentage change from comparable week in 2022Occupancy: 64.8 percent (up 0.8 percent)ADR: $156.01 (up 4.0 percent)RevPAR: $101.13 (up 4.9 percent) Among the Top 25 Markets, Denver saw the largest year-over-year occupancy lift (up 9.0 percent to 69.3 percent).
